Transaction d86b5caa7c12324ee0d662f8725327680d2fcdcfe96b358a5eb71964fba53f24
1 Input
1 Output
-
d86b5caa7c12324ee0d662f8725327680d2fcdcfe96b358a5eb71964fba53f24:0
- value
- 338843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c640f5bdf2203edcdca809ff684d2125ba04a9a OP_EQUAL
- address
- 35jjXGtEkawKaNxNBvdcqHu5GDXh7H9Het